About the Role

The Construction Site Manager will oversee the on-site delivery of a major Wind Farm Project during the construction and commissioning phases. Reporting to the Project Director, this role will lead day-to-day site activities, coordinate contractors and stakeholders, and ensure projects are delivered safely, on schedule and in line with contractual obligations.

This is a highly visible leadership role responsible for maintaining strong safety culture, managing contractor performance and supporting the successful delivery of utility-scale renewable projects.

Responsibilities
  • Manage day-to-day construction activities across civil, electrical and installation works.
  • Coordinate contractors, subcontractors, OEM technicians and site personnel.
  • Ensure works are delivered in line with project schedule, contracts and quality requirements.
  • Lead site safety initiatives and enforce WHS compliance.
  • Conduct site inspections, risk assessments and incident investigations.
  • Monitor construction progress and provide regular reports to project stakeholders.
  • Support contract administration, procurement and mobilisation activities.
  • Liaise with project owners, engineers, grid stakeholders, landowners and local authorities.
  • Maintain accurate site documentation including permits, drawings, reports and QA/QC records.
